About The Position

Works under general supervision to provide technical assistance in administration of physical therapy treatment to patients. Responsible for providing physical therapy services for patients in strict compliance with plan of care developed by professional physical therapist.

Responsibilities

  • Provide physical therapy as specified in the physical therapy plan of care, which may include:
  • Implementing treatment programs that include therapeutic exercises, gait training and techniques, ADL training, administration of the therapeutic heat and cold, ultrasound, electric current, and goniometric measurement.
  • Modify treatment techniques as indicated in the plan of care.
  • Obtain copy of plan of care made by PT and provide care exactly as written.
  • Respond to acute changes.
  • Teach patient/caregiver to perform selected treatment procedures.
  • Identify architectural barriers.
  • Demonstrate appropriate written, oral, and non-verbal communication with patients, families, and colleagues.
  • Demonstrates safe, ethical, and legal practice.
  • Notify supervising PT and Clinical Supervisor of any patient's change in condition.
  • Attend case conferences.
  • Inform supervising PT of last scheduled visit one week prior so that PT can schedule to see patient on the last visit.
